At Autodesk, our Architecture, Engineering, and Construction (AEC) Data Model team is focused on shaping the future of how customers access, manage, and unlock value from their data across the project and asset lifecycle. We design the APIs, services, and user interfaces that power Autodesk’s data platform ecosystem and enable critical AEC workflows.
As a Senior Experience Designer – AEC Platform Data, you will collaborate closely with Product Management, Engineering, User Research, and Design partners to drive the experience strategy for complex, data-driven platform products. You will help shape how customers and developers interact with granular project and asset data, enabling powerful new insights and more connected workflows across Autodesk’s ecosystem.
We are looking for a designer who is a strong human-centered design advocate, a creative problem-solver, and a high-impact facilitator. This designer must be someone who is passionate about crafting world-class platform experiences in technically complex and ambiguous problem spaces. Responsibilities- Partner with product managers, engineers, user researchers, and designers to define and deliver great experiences from initial concept through successful implementation.
- Collaborate across teams to ensure design work remains aligned with adjacent products and platform initiatives.
- Visualize and prototype solutions at multiple levels of fidelity, from high-level wireframes to testable, interactive high-fidelity prototypes.
- Rapidly develop and validate experience concepts through internal reviews and direct user feedback.
- Facilitate and participate in design thinking workshops, brainstorming sessions, and cross-functional working sessions.
- Apply and contribute to design system standards to ensure consistency and cohesion across platform experiences.
- Lead design presentations and discussions with a broad range of stakeholders and audiences.
- Maintain close contact with users through interviews, field research, and user events, translating insights into new and improved experiences.
- Research user interface trends and emerging technologies, assessing their potential impact on data-centric user experiences.
